Charitable Trust
A legal arrangement in which assets are held and managed by one party for charitable purposes, providing benefit to the public or a segment of the public.
Museum
An institution dedicated to collecting, preserving, exhibiting, and interpreting artifacts and works of significant historical, cultural, or artistic value.
Express Trust
A trust explicitly created by a settlor, typically in a written document, specifying how trust assets are to be managed and distributed.
Voluntary Action
An act done by choice or free will, without external compulsion.
